As I get older the eyes are not as forgiving as they used to be. I have tried playing with glasses but I find it hard getting down on shots. I have contacts but I am near sighted so the correction of the contacts does not allow me to see things up close. So what is my fix? I have started to play with one contact in my left eye. I can see 4+ feet away in my left eye and see up close with my right eye.

Anyone else had to resort to this?

I have a special pair of contacts that I wear only for playing pool. I asked my eye doctor to prescribe a pair for "mid range", about 12-15 feet. Not quite for reading nor distance.

They don't work too well for driving, so I bring them with me and place them in at the room.

Works great.

These things are dorky looking as all hell, but a lot of nearsighted players are getting them. Two older guys who play a lot of 14.1 at my local room swear by them. They are available with progressive lenses so you can see both close and far away with them.

I made mine myself.... I used an old pair of frames, got a good prescription & now I have great pair of Pool Glasses.

They are jacked up on the nose piece & tilted out. When I am down on the shot, I am looking straight through the lens, no aberration in my vision. They made a tremendous difference.
